Work-relatedness of carpal tunnel syndrome: Systematic review including meta-analysis and GRADE.

Awa HassanAnnechien BeumerPaul P F M KuijerHenk F van der Molen
Published in: Health science reports (2022)
This systematic review of prospective cohort studies found high certainty for an increased rate of CTS due to a high Strain Index, exposures exceeding the Activity Level of ACGIH, and high force intensity and high repetition. Workers performing tasks requiring both high force and high repetition even have a higher rate of developing CTS.
